SQL中的NVL函數和IFNULL函數都用于處理空值或NULL值,但是它們在不同的數據庫管理系統中有所不同。
NVL函數是Oracle數據庫中使用的函數,語法為:NVL(expr1, expr2)。如果expr1為NULL,則返回expr2,否則返回expr1。
IFNULL函數是MySQL數據庫中使用的函數,語法為:IFNULL(expr1, expr2)。如果expr1為NULL,則返回expr2,否則返回expr1。
總的來說,NVL函數和IFNULL函數的功能相似,都是用于處理空值或NULL值的情況,只是在不同的數據庫管理系統中使用不同的函數名稱和語法。